Overview

Dynein axonemal assembly factor 19 (DNAAF19), also known as CCDC103, is a cytoplasmic protein required for the assembly of axonemal dynein complexes, which are essential for the motility of cilia. DNAAF19 is a coiled-coil domain-containing protein thought to facilitate protein-protein interactions necessary for proper dynein arm formation and attachment in motile cilia. It plays critical roles in processes such as cilium movement and determination of left-right body symmetry during development. Mutations in DNAAF19 are implicated in primary ciliary dyskinesia—a genetic disorder characterized by impaired ciliary function leading to chronic respiratory tract infections, randomization of organ laterality, and, in some cases, infertility. There are no known drugs that target this protein, and it is not considered a direct therapeutic target.
